आप से मिलकर ख़ुशी हुई (aap se milkar khushi hui) means I am happy to have met you, a phrase offered after an introduction rather than before it. It closes the small ritual of meeting someone new with genuine warmth. The phrase uses khushi, happiness, discussed elsewhere as a word of daily life, showing how the same vocabulary threads through greetings, feelings and formal courtesy alike in Hindi.
Learning one useful word often opens several others at once. For learners, this phrase is worth memorising as a complete unit rather than building word by word at first. Saying it smoothly after an introduction leaves a strong, warm impression, even before your Hindi grammar is fully steady.
This phrase pairs naturally with a simple follow up, aap kya karte hain, what do you do, a common next question once introductions are complete. Learning small, connected sequences like this, rather than isolated phrases, makes a first conversation in Hindi feel considerably less daunting to begin.
